  • Are polyacrylamide gels stable?
  • Polyacrylamide gels The stability of polyacrylamide (PAAm) gels, synthesized by free radical polymerization of acrylamide (AAm) and N, N ′-methylenebisacrylamide (BIS), was investigated when subjected to thermal and irradiation conditions. The PAAm gels were stable and did not release AAm under fluorescent light.
  • What is a polyacrylamide hydrogel (Paag)?
  • Analysis of polyacrylamide hydrogel (PAAG) has attracted worldwide attention. Difference chromatographic method has been utilised for the determination of this polymer . Actually, PAAG is a polyacrylamide mixture, formed by the polymerisation of acrylamide monomers and water.
